Voice-to-text has moved beyond simple transcription, but it still depends on the microphones built into laptops and phones — and that, according to WIRED reporter Julian Chokkattu, is the gap a new London startup called Relay is attacking. Relay is building the Relay Q, a dedicated portable microphone for high-fidelity voice-to-text anywhere, paired with a macOS app that can transcribe speech, correct misspoken sentences, and automate actions inside other applications. The software debuts now; the Relay Q hardware follows in early 2027, WIRED reported.
Why a keyboard is the bottleneck
Relay's founding story is rooted in the shortcomings of existing dictation tools. Raymond Zhu, Relay's co-founder and formerly a hardware product manager at Nothing, told WIRED that he and co-founder Cookie Xu — Nothing's former head of AI and services — used Wispr Flow's transcription software to "type" most of their messages at work. The software helped them think through ideas, he said, but the office created a physical problem.
"In the office, we never really could get the right volume for input," Zhu told WIRED. "If I whisper too quietly, the Mac wouldn't be able to pick it up; too loud and my coworker next to me can hear." He added: "It calls for dedicated hardware."
That experience shaped the product roadmap. Relay is starting with desktop instead of mobile because Zhu believes work conversations are the most complex, WIRED reported — chats with friends and family are simple on phones, but in front of a computer people share ideas, brainstorm, and use varied tone and formality.

How the Relay app works
Chokkattu tested a beta version of the macOS app with and without the dedicated microphone. During setup, users choose a hotkey — the default is Fn — then press and hold it while the cursor sits in any text field to activate dictation. The transcription engine is powered by Google's Gemini models.
Relay can also perform contextual actions it calls Skills. One Skill, for example, asks Relay to message a colleague in Slack; Relay launches the app, finds the recipient, and drafts the text. Chokkattu reported trouble with that Slack skill in testing, but the app successfully crafted a calendar event in Google Calendar. Preset Skills exist for WhatsApp and Gmail, and users can make their own and connect other apps.
Privacy trade-offs and the early verdict
Skills require sweeping system permissions. Relay needs microphone access, and users can grant it permission to record a snapshot of the screen whenever it is activated — that screen capture is how Skills identify what to automate. The company says data is stored locally on the user's device, where users can manually edit or delete it. When data is sent for processing, it passes through Relay's servers in transit to Google's servers, but Relay does not retain it. Chokkattu noted that granting AI models a view of the operating system adds inherent privacy and security trade-offs, similar to Microsoft's Recall feature.
Hands-on results were mixed. Relay's transcription was not as impressive as Google's Rambler feature on the Pixel 11 series, Chokkattu wrote; it does not capture every word perfectly and sometimes misplaces punctuation. It does understand when the speaker misspeaks and restates a sentence, cutting the parts that do not matter. Emoji insertion was inconsistent: when Chokkattu asked for a heart emoji, Relay did it flawlessly, but when he tried to add the same request at the end of a sentence, it typed out "heart emoji."
The competitive field
Relay enters a market that WIRED describes as software-focused. Wispr Flow can join meetings to summarize discussions, and Google is debuting smarter on-device dictation on its latest Pixel smartphone. Relay's differentiation is dedicated hardware: a portable microphone for high-fidelity voice-to-text anywhere, built to solve the office-volume problem Zhu described.
WIRED's testing suggests the software is functional but not yet best-in-class at transcription, and the Skills automation carries real privacy costs. The company plans to bring the app to Windows, iOS, and Android, with the Relay Q arriving in early 2027.
